About this House

The loft boasts hardwood floors throughout, stainless steel appliances, and beautiful natural lighting from the tall windows. The space includes one parking spot behind the building that can be accessed from the massive rear porch, as well was water and garbage utilities.
109 E Oglethorpe Ave #B, Savannah, GA 31401 is a 2 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,000 sqft townhouse in North Historic District, built in 1820. More recently, it was listed as a rental in September 2024 with an asking price of $3,000 per month. That rental listing was removed on April 1, 2025. This property is not currently displayed as for sale or rent on Trulia. The Trulia Estimate is $598,200, with a rent estimate of $2,358/month.

  • Joseph W.
    "The Bull Street corridor: the beating heart of downtown Savannah. All points of interest from Forsyth Park to the riverfront are within a ten-minute walk. Restaurants of all types and price ranges. Bars, banks, trendy shopping. You name it, it's all here except parking; that's a big hassle."
